Looking to get back into the Audi fold after around 6 months away
(Quick potted history-had C6 RS6 for a year and loved it, went for the C7 RS6 which whilst awesome I had to let it go as I couldn’t justify the massive outlay every month).
Have been in a FL A45 for around 4 months now and whilst the good points (chassis, grip and B road munching capability) are great the bad points (too many to list unfortunately) are really grinding me down to the point that the car is frustrating most of the time. It’s stock apart from a ‘Peddle Box’ although I have a Tricolore Performance Stage 1 Box ready to be fitted.
Ideally a latest model RS3 saloon would be a good fit or even an S4/5. However a suggestion has been the facelifted S3 saloon and then tune it?
Question here is the difference between S3 and RS3 that great? I’ve driven neither and would go for the saloon. Online the price difference is pretty huge-around £15-18k for a low miles well specc’d one.
I paid £36k for the A45 (I really don’t think they are worth the new price of around £52k for a well specc’d one) so the £45-49k for an RS3 is quite a difference (although my C7 RS6 was around £70k).

By way of an update I test drove an RS3 saloon a while ago and I really expected to be totally blown away by it and lust after it....that just didn’t happen which shocked me. I also test drove an S5 and a B7 RS5 (S5 surprisingly quick and impressive, the RS5 felt solid, stuck to the road but way down on torque and felt dated tech wise). Fast cornering on the RS3 I could feel some understeer coming on but overall while it was a great car it didn’t have the affect I was hoping for! Maybe it’s because I need a larger car, could t put my finger on a single point but was enough for me to look at other models.
Have been looking at RS7’s and test drove a pre FL 2014 one with most of the must have options ticked. Huge delivery and looked great, felt very heavy though (that’s what happens when you drive a lighter car) and also dated inside?
On a whim I went to BMW and drove an M3 Competition Pack and the handling and drive was frankly sublime....conditions were dry and it just handled better than any Audi I’ve ever driven (sorry Audi). Tech was bang on and it’s cheaper than the RS7, newer and with great tech. Very very strong contender and I wasn’t looking for a RWD car...trouble is the UK is a damp country and thats where AWD comes into its own.
